当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器中转站,中转服务器搭建脚本最新

服务器中转站,中转服务器搭建脚本最新

本文主要介绍了服务器中转站以及中转服务器搭建脚本的最新情况。服务器中转站在网络通信中起到重要作用,它能够高效地传输数据。而中转服务器搭建脚本的最新版本则提供了更便捷、高...

***:本文主要介绍了服务器中转站,即中转服务器搭建脚本的最新情况。文中可能会详细讲解中转服务器的作用、搭建的必要性以及其在数据传输、网络通信等方面的重要性。对于搭建脚本的最新内容,或许会涉及到版本更新、功能改进、优化等方面,以适应不断变化的网络环境和用户需求。通过使用最新的搭建脚本,用户能够更高效、便捷地搭建中转服务器,提升网络性能和数据传输效率。

标题:《搭建高效中转服务器:提升网络数据传输的利器》

服务器中转站,中转服务器搭建脚本最新

在当今数字化的时代,网络数据的传输和共享变得至关重要,无论是企业内部的文件共享、跨地域的团队协作,还是个人用户对大量数据的快速传输,都需要一个稳定、高效的中转服务器来保障,本文将详细介绍如何搭建一个最新的中转服务器,以及它在网络数据传输中的重要性和优势。

一、中转服务器的概念和作用

中转服务器,顾名思义,是一个在数据传输过程中起到中间转接作用的服务器,它可以接收来自客户端的请求,并将请求转发到目标服务器,同时将目标服务器的响应返回给客户端,通过中转服务器,客户端可以绕过直接连接目标服务器的限制,实现更灵活、高效的数据传输。

中转服务器的作用主要体现在以下几个方面:

1、突破网络限制:在某些情况下,客户端可能无法直接连接到目标服务器,例如由于网络防火墙的限制、地理位置的限制等,中转服务器可以作为桥梁,帮助客户端绕过这些限制,实现与目标服务器的通信。

2、提高传输效率:中转服务器可以缓存部分数据,减少重复的数据传输,从而提高数据传输的效率,中转服务器还可以对数据进行压缩和加密,进一步提高传输的速度和安全性。

3、增强安全性:中转服务器可以对客户端和目标服务器之间的通信进行过滤和监控,防止恶意软件和网络攻击的入侵,中转服务器还可以对数据进行加密,保障数据的安全性和隐私性。

4、实现负载均衡:当有大量客户端同时访问目标服务器时,可能会导致目标服务器的负载过高,影响服务质量,中转服务器可以将客户端的请求分发到多个目标服务器上,实现负载均衡,提高系统的整体性能。

二、中转服务器的搭建环境

在搭建中转服务器之前,需要准备以下环境:

1、服务器:一台性能稳定的服务器,建议使用 Linux 系统,如 CentOS、Ubuntu 等。

2、网络环境:服务器需要连接到互联网,并且具有公网 IP 地址。

3、端口:需要开放一些端口,以便客户端和中转服务器之间的通信,常用的端口包括 80、443、22 等。

4、软件:需要安装一些中转服务器相关的软件,如 Squid、V2Ray 等。

三、中转服务器的搭建步骤

1、安装 Squid 服务器:Squid 是一个开源的代理服务器,可以实现缓存、加速、过滤等功能,以下是安装 Squid 服务器的步骤:

(1)更新系统软件包:

sudo yum update

(2)安装 Squid 服务器:

sudo yum install squid

(3)启动 Squid 服务器:

服务器中转站,中转服务器搭建脚本最新

sudo systemctl start squid

(4)设置 Squid 服务器开机自启动:

sudo systemctl enable squid

2、配置 Squid 服务器:安装完成后,需要对 Squid 服务器进行配置,以满足实际需求,以下是一些常见的配置项:

(1)设置缓存目录:

sudo vi /etc/squid/squid.conf

在文件中找到以下行:

cache_dir ufs /var/spool/squid 100 16 256

将其修改为:

cache_dir ufs /var/spool/squid 500 16 256

这将增加缓存目录的大小,提高缓存效果。

(2)设置访问控制:

sudo vi /etc/squid/squid.conf

在文件中找到以下行:

http_access allow all

将其修改为:

http_access deny all
http_access allow 192.168.1.0/24

这将限制只有 192.168.1.0/24 网段的客户端可以访问 Squid 服务器。

(3)设置端口转发:

sudo vi /etc/squid/squid.conf

在文件中找到以下行:

http_port 3128

将其修改为:

http_port 8080

这将更改 Squid 服务器的监听端口,以便与其他服务器进行通信。

3、安装 V2Ray 服务器:V2Ray 是一个开源的网络代理工具,可以实现翻墙、加速等功能,以下是安装 V2Ray 服务器的步骤:

(1)更新系统软件包:

sudo yum update

(2)安装 V2Ray 服务器:

sudo yum install v2ray

(3)启动 V2Ray 服务器:

sudo systemctl start v2ray

(4)设置 V2Ray 服务器开机自启动:

服务器中转站,中转服务器搭建脚本最新

sudo systemctl enable v2ray

4、配置 V2Ray 服务器:安装完成后,需要对 V2Ray 服务器进行配置,以满足实际需求,以下是一些常见的配置项:

(1)设置端口转发:

sudo vi /etc/v2ray/config.json

在文件中找到以下行:

"inbounds": [
{
"port": 1080,
"protocol": "socks",
"settings": {
"auth": "noauth"
}
}
],
"outbounds": [
{
"protocol": "freedom",
"settings": {}
}
]

将其修改为:

"inbounds": [
{
"port": 8080,
"protocol": "http",
"settings": {
"auth": "noauth"
}
}
],
"outbounds": [
{
"protocol": "vmess",
"settings": {
"vnext": [
{
"address": "your-v2ray-server-ip",
"port": 443,
"users": [
{
"id": "your-v2ray-server-id",
"alterId": 64
}
]
}
]
}
}
]

这将更改 V2Ray 服务器的监听端口,并设置与 Squid 服务器的通信。

5、测试中转服务器:配置完成后,需要测试中转服务器是否正常工作,可以使用以下命令测试:

curl -x 127.0.0.1:8080 http://www.baidu.com

如果能够正常访问百度网站,则说明中转服务器已经搭建成功。

四、中转服务器的优化和安全措施

为了提高中转服务器的性能和安全性,还需要进行一些优化和安全措施:

1、优化缓存策略:根据实际需求,调整缓存目录的大小和缓存策略,以提高缓存效果。

2、加强访问控制:除了设置访问控制列表外,还可以使用身份验证和授权机制,进一步加强访问控制。

3、安装防火墙:安装防火墙,限制对中转服务器的访问,防止恶意攻击。

4、定期更新软件:定期更新 Squid 和 V2Ray 等软件,以修复安全漏洞。

5、监控服务器状态:使用监控工具,实时监控中转服务器的状态,及时发现和解决问题。

五、总结

中转服务器在网络数据传输中扮演着重要的角色,通过搭建中转服务器,可以突破网络限制,提高传输效率,增强安全性,实现负载均衡等功能,本文详细介绍了如何搭建一个最新的中转服务器,并提供了一些优化和安全措施,希望本文能够对读者有所帮助,让读者能够更好地利用中转服务器提升网络数据传输的性能和安全性。

黑狐家游戏

发表评论

最新文章